We decided to brave the sweltering heat last night and do some flyball training. There were only a few of us there due to holidays and the like so we kept it short. Our main goal was to see if Jet could learn to overcome her Shaq obsession - that love-of-her-life border collie. If you have never seen them together you can't really appreciate how much of a challenge this presents but trust me...it is our Mount Everest.
We started by doing some "Shaq walk-bys". As simple as can you walk anywhere in his vicinity and leave him alone and focus on mom? The first few attempts - not so much - but we did get to the point where the mackerel cakes won out over Shaq.
Next - can you go to the box and get your ball with Shaq just standing in the other lane in your peripheral vision - success after two attempts. Ok deep breath - next level - can you do it if Shaq is going for his ball at the box at the same time...of course this might work better if Shaq didn't decide he wanted Jet's ball out of her box and crossed over to get it...thanks Shaq - I guess he didn't get the memo...I am sure he was just trying to help her out by showing her how it was done :)
Ok - now for the big test - can you do it from two hurdles back to the box and the full down the lane on return after listening to Shaq come flying down the other lane and smash into the box - have to get the timing right - don't let her go until her boy toy is off the box on his way back (btw - this takes about a blink of the eye as Shaq is a speed demon). SUCCESS!!!! I could have picked her up and hugged her - oh wait I think I did!!
Of course like any good trainer we quit there...well just one more since we were on a roll. Even better the second time (with me whispering into her ear - leave it, leave it, get your ball, where's your ball the entire time).
This does not a flyball bully make, but we are on our way and I can smell the racing lanes (well almost).
